Who Are Our Puppy Nannies?
Our Puppy Nannies are carefully screened stay-at-home moms with a natural gift for nurturing and a passion for animals. They’re not hobby breeders or outside contractors—they’re part of our team. Each Nanny:
Receives hands-on training from us across several litters
Is fully trained in our protocols, routines, and care practices
Stays in close communication with our team throughout the process
Each Nanny family raises only one litter at a time to ensure that every puppy receives the round-the-clock care, socialization, and attention they need in their most formative weeks.
Inside a Puppy Nanny Home
From birth through six weeks of age, our Nanny-raised puppies live in clean, calm, family-centered homes where they’re nurtured like one of the family.
Puppies raised in a Puppy Nanny home experience:
In-home care from birth to 6 weeks old
Exposure to children, household sounds, cats, and typical daily routines
Age-appropriate socialization: gentle handling, noise desensitization, crate and potty introduction, and confidence-building activities
A structured early development plan focused on emotional well-being and resilience

What Happens After 6 Weeks?
At six weeks old, the puppies return to us for their final stage of development before going to their forever homes. During this time, we:
Continue crate and potty training foundations
Introduce new experiences and build confidence
Conduct temperament evaluations to help match puppies with the right families
Begin transitional training to help them settle smoothly into their new homes

What’s the difference between Guardian Homes and Puppy Nanny Families?
Guardian Home
Purpose: Provide a permanent, loving home for one of our breeding dogs.
What They Do:
Raise one of our breeding dogs (usually from puppyhood) as their full-time family pet.
Allow Pacific Northwest Doodles to retain breeding rights for a set period (outlined in a contract).
Once the breeding career is complete, full ownership is transferred to the Guardian family.
The dog lives with the Guardian family for life.
Think of it as: Giving a breeding dog the opportunity to live a full, family-centered life instead of being housed in a kennel environment.

Puppy Nanny Families
Purpose: Raise a single litter of puppies in their home from birth to around 6 weeks of age.
What They Do:
Temporary care for one litter at a time, in their home.
Follow our structured training, socialization, and care protocols.
Receive hands-on training and ongoing support from the Pacific Northwest Doodles team.
Puppies return to us at 6 weeks for continued training and evaluation before going to their forever families.
Think of it as: A temporary, nurturing role focused on the critical early weeks of puppy development.
Ideal for: Stay-at-home parents or individuals with flexible schedules who love puppies and want to help raise well-adjusted dogs without a long-term ownership commitment.
